Portal hypertension (PHT) is characterized by splanchnic hyperemia due to a reduction in mesenteric vascular resistance. The reasons for the decreased resistance include an increased responsiveness to a vasodilator substance. The hemodynamic effects of long-term administration of octreotide in portal hypertension has not been established. In addition, whether long-term octreotide treatment prevents the development of portosystemic shunts has not yet been evaluated.
